The Gap No One Is Talking About
Expectation Without Education
Dentistry holds patient experience teams accountable for failed outcomes — without ever training them in dentistry itself.
Front office teams discuss procedures they’ve haven't learned or even seen.
Treatment coordinators explain care they have very little understanding of.
Insurance conversations fail without clinical clarity & insight.
Case acceptance depends on the "figure it out" method.
White-glove communication is impossible without clinical understanding.
Dentistry demands it — but doesn’t teach the dentistry behind it.
